PlumbGuard
Preventing fatal electrocution on worksites
Developed to address a critical safety gap following multiple fatalities, PlumbGuard detects electrical hazards in water pipes before work begins.
• Over 7,000 units deployed
• Adopted across major water authorities
• Award-winning Australian industrial product

IND.T
Early fault detection for power networks
A world-first system designed to detect and locate faults on electrical distribution networks before they cause outages or bushfires.
• Leading product in its class globally
• Production batches of 4,000 units
• Exporting internationally, including the United States
Transforms advanced research into a scalable, manufacturable product.

Blair Digital Chanter
The world’s leading digital bagpipe
Developed with a professional musician, the Blair Digital Chanter evolved from a practice tool into a globally recognised performance instrument.
• Designed and manufactured in Melbourne
• Used by players worldwide
• Leading professional digital chanter globally
